Read this for our suicide tactics rule: http://www.tacticalgamer.com/battlef...e-tactics.html
The key sentence to note being the following:
Lots of accidents happen in bf2 that result in a players unintended suicide. Our focus in on those intentional acts...tactics if you will, where the player intends to die or shows no care for his life. Some prime examples of this rule are jihad jeeps, ramming and driving around just to run people over(you know your joyride will be short lived). So do not focus on every instance where a player accidently misjudged his distance to his c4 blast or someone got surprised around a corner and shot an rpg at his feet. That happens to everybody no matter how hard they try not to.Suicide tactics are defined as any action which intentionally results in your death in order to take the life of another.|TG-12th|mantis

A tip on the use of C4.
In BF2 any object that can block bullets can block C4 explosions. After setting C4 jump behind any close by object(tree, low wall, dip/rise in the ground, a fallen log, small rock). The key is to imagine the C4 shotting a bullet out in every direction from the center of it and making sure something is in between you and the C4.
